    Abstract: Provided are a method and device for responding to a registration request. The method includes: an Alloc-ID configuration table sent by an Optical Line Terminal (OLT) is received, the Alloc-ID configuration table including corresponding relationships between Alloc-IDs and upstream rates; the Alloc-ID configuration table is parsed to determine a target Alloc-ID from the corresponding relationships between the Alloc-IDs and the upstream rates, the rates corresponding to the target Alloc-ID including the rate supported by an Optical Network Unit (ONU); and a registration request sent by the OLT is responded to based on the target Alloc-ID, the registration request carrying the target Alloc-ID.

    Abstract: A data coding processing method and apparatus, a storage medium, and an electronic device are provided. The method includes: acquiring discontinuous data from a plurality of data blocks used for Forward Error Correction (FEC) coding to form a plurality of target data blocks; determining parity information of FEC code words respectively according to the plurality of target data blocks, so as to obtain a plurality of pieces of parity information; and forming coded data by the plurality of pieces of parity information and the plurality of data blocks used for FEC coding.

    Abstract: Provided are a preamble sending method and apparatus and a preamble receiving method and apparatus. The preamble sending method includes sending a preamble containing two or more code pattern sequences, where the two or more code pattern sequences comprise a first code pattern sequence and a second code pattern sequence. That is, by enabling the preamble to support different code pattern sequences, the rapid transmission of the preamble is implemented by using functions corresponding to the different code pattern sequences, and thus the rapid equalization convergence can be performed after the rate of a passive optical network is improved, thereby improving the transmission efficiency and decreasing the processing delay. Through the preceding technical solutions, the problems in the related art that equalization time is long, transmission efficiency is reduced and processing delay is increased due to the fact that a preamble is not conducive to the convergence of an equalizer are solved.

    Abstract: Provided is a coherent detection implementing apparatus, system and method. The apparatus includes: a first transceiver unit, configured to send an optical signal in a first direction to a second device, wherein the optical signal in the first direction includes a direct current optical signal with a first wavelength and a modulated optical signal with a second wavelength; and configured to receive an optical signal in a second direction from the second device; and a first coherent receiver, connected with the first transceiver unit, and configured to take a part of the direct current optical signal with the first wavelength in the optical signal in the first direction as a Local Oscillator (LO) light for coherent reception, perform coherent frequency mixing between the LO light and the optical signal in the second direction, and demodulate the optical signal in the second direction.

    Abstract: The present disclosure discloses an optical signal receiving apparatus, an optical line terminal, an optical signal receiving system, an optical signal receiving method, and a computer-readable storage medium. The optical signal receiving apparatus is configured to receive optical signals at multiple speeds, and includes: a filter and at least one detector; the filter is disposed following an amplifier, filter characteristics of the filter are configured according to a preset wavelength range, and the filter is configured to filter out noise in optical signals amplified by the amplifier and perform wavelength division processing on the optical signals to obtain at least one optical signal corresponding to the preset wavelength range; and the at least one detector is configured to convert the at least one optical signal into an electrical signal.
